Ms. Jerri L. DeVard is Independent Director of the Company. Jerri has more than 30 years of extensive multicultural marketing, eCommerce, brand management and leadership experience at large global brands. Jerri currently serves as the Executive Vice President and Chief Customer Officer of Office Depot, Inc., a global supplier of office products and services, where she leads the eCommerce and Customer Service functions, as well as Marketing and Communications. She initially joined Office Depot as Executive Vice President and Chief Marketing Officer in September of 2017, shortly before Office Depot acquired CompuCom Systems Inc. as part of its strategic transformation to a broader business services and technology products platform. From March 2014 until May 2016, Jerri also served as the Vice President and Chief Marketing Officer of The ADT Corporationrationration, a leading provider of home and business security services. She led ADTs marketing efforts and oversaw all strategic, operational and financial aspects of its integrated marketing programs, which included brand advertising, digital marketing, communications, lead generation, sponsorships and more. From July 2012 to March 2014, Jerri was Principal of DeVard Marketing Group, a firm specializing in advertising, branding, communications and traditionaldigitalmulticultural marketing strategies. Prior to that, she served as the Executive Vice President and Chief Marketing Officer of Nokia Corporation from January 2011 to June 2012. Additionally, from 1998 until January 2003, she served as Chief Marketing Officer at Citi. Jerri has also held senior marketing roles at Verizon Communications Inc., Revlon Inc., Harrahs Entertainment, Inc., the NFLs Minnesota Vikings and the Pillsbury Company. Jerri holds an MBA in Marketing from Atlanta University Graduate School of Business and a BA in Economics from Spelman College, where she served as a member of the board of trustees from 2005 to 2014. since 2017.

Cars.com Inc. operates as a digital marketplace and provides solutions for the automotive industry. Cars.com Inc. was founded in 1998 and is based in Chicago, Illinois. Cars operates under Auto Truck Dealerships classification in the United States and is traded on New York Stock Exchange. It employs 1600 people. Cars Inc (CARS) is traded on New York Stock Exchange in USA. It is located in 300 South Riverside Plaza, Chicago, IL, United States, 60606 and employs 1,800 people. Cars is listed under Interactive Media & Services category by Fama And French industry classification.
